Purpose: To Carry out Administration duties for the Quality Department.
.
Job Description:
Β· Attending QA leadership team meeting
Β· Responsible for updating quality documents and operational procedures to reflect current working requirements.
Β· Document Librarian, managing Oshens document library with up-to-date reversions, adding new documents and archiving old documents.
Β· Maintaining the resin approval matrix, both excel file and updates to Sys-pro
Β· Raising purchase orders on Sys-pro for the leadership team and engineers
Β· Complete the quality section on the new product request forms.
Β· HQ warehouse administrator, moving NCP items into and out of HQ.
Β· Attending HQ monthly meeting and keeping the leadership team up to date
Β· Raising stock disposal forms
Β· Supporting internal and external audits, Customer visits
Β· Using Sys-pro to gather product information for the leadership and engineers.
Β· Manage Departments holiday tracker.
Β· Generate Monthly reports where applicable.
Β· Scan applicable documents and achieve where required daily.
Β· Organise Operations/Technical Board Pack/Presentation Monthly
Β· Assisting in the maintenance of an up-to-date system for the receipt and filing of Supplier related documentation such as Certificates of Analysis and certificates of conformity
Β· The pulling together of batch passport documentation.
Β· Pulling together certificates of analysis for supplier products when requested by international Customers
